Why "Waka Waka" Still Rocks After All These Years

"Waka Waka" isn't just a song; it's a cultural phenomenon. Released in 2010, it quickly became a global sensation, thanks to its infectious rhythm, Shakira's energetic vocals, and its association with the FIFA World Cup in South Africa. But what makes it so special and why does it endure even today?

First off, let's talk about the rhythm. The song cleverly incorporates elements of Cameroonian Makossa music, giving it a unique and authentic African vibe that sets it apart from typical pop songs. This blend of global pop sensibilities with local African sounds is a masterstroke that makes you want to get up and dance, no matter where you are from. The catchy beat is undeniably one of the reasons why it sticks in your head and has you humming along hours after you've heard it.

Then there's Shakira. Her distinctive voice, combined with her incredible stage presence, brought the song to life. She isn't just singing; she's embodying the spirit of the World Cup and the energy of Africa. The passion and excitement in her delivery are palpable, making the song an instant classic. Her involvement gave the song massive international appeal, drawing in fans from all corners of the globe.

The Cultural Impact of "Waka Waka"

When "Waka Waka (This Time for Africa)" exploded onto the global stage, it wasn't just a hit song; it became a cultural phenomenon. Its impact reached far beyond the realm of music, influencing everything from dance trends to perceptions of Africa on a global scale. Let's explore the far-reaching effects of this iconic anthem.

One of the most significant impacts of "Waka Waka" was its role in promoting African culture to a global audience. By incorporating elements of Cameroonian Makossa music, the song introduced millions of people to a sound they might never have encountered otherwise. This fusion of global pop with local African music helped to break down cultural barriers and foster a greater appreciation for the diversity of African music.

Furthermore, the song's association with the FIFA World Cup in South Africa helped to showcase the beauty and vibrancy of the African continent. The music video, with its scenes of African dancers and landscapes, challenged negative stereotypes and presented a more positive and nuanced image of Africa to the world. For many, "Waka Waka" became a symbol of African pride and potential.
